Abstract:
A footrest for a shower is disclosed. The footrest is adapted to be
mounted in a corner of a shower stall. In various forms, the footrest
includes a top surface for resting a foot during bathing or shaving. The
top surface is concavely contoured to resist lateral slipping. Ideally,
the top surface conforms substantially to the shape of a portion of the
surface of a cone. Two mounting flanges extend downward from the footrest
element for mounting to shower walls, either by adhesive or screws. In
certain variations, cutout openings in the surface of the footrest assist
in resisting slipping in a forward or backward direction. The footrest
may be adjusted by applying pressure to the top or bottom surface to
change the mounting angle. Thus, the device can be deformed to conform to
the angle of a corner which is not formed exactly as a right angle.Claims:

Description:
BACKGROUND OF THE INVENTION
[0001] 1. Field of the Invention
[0002] The present invention relates to footrest, and more particularly, to a footrest adapted for use in a shower.
[0003] 2. Background
[0004] There has been, and continues to be a need to have a suitable way in which to rest a foot in the shower when bathing or shaving. Various devices have been proposed as footrest devices for shower stalls. For example, devices as simple as a step stool have been used in shower stalls.
[0005] Some common types of devices currently available rely on suction cups for mounting. These devices require a very smooth surface for the suction cups to adhere. The suction cups eventually fail and are not a permanent solution.
[0006] Some devices use adhesives for mounting. Generally their plastic construction is not durable enough making them undesirable for high end shower installations.
[0007] Some devices provide foot support by means of a small stool or platform with legs that rest on the shower floor. These solutions are similarly unable to meet the needs of the industry because they are generally too large and inappropriate for use in smaller showers. Still other devices create support by mounting to a single side wall instead of a corner. These devices are more intrusive when used in small showers.
[0008] Generally, most devices currently available are temporary or portable plastic devices that do not fill the industry need for a more stable, more permanent, high quality piece of shower hardware.
[0009] In U.S. Pat. No. 5,340,070, issued to Soma, discloses a leg shave plate. The device is mounted to a shower wall. However, the device fails to prevent slipping of the foot in either the lateral or frontward and backward directions. Furthermore, in the event the walls of the shower corner do not meet in a 90 degree angle, there is no ability to adjust the plate to fit the configuration of the walls.
[0010] U.S. Pat. No. 5,647,072 issued to Shaffer et al., discloses a footrest for a shower. However, the footrest cannot be adjusted for different mounting angles, and fails to adequately prevent slipping. Similarly, other conventional devices are not adjustable and do not adequately prevent slipping, or have other inadequacies which render them less than ideal.
[0011] Thus, there remains a need for a footrest device which is convenient, resists slipping, and is adjustable.
SUMMARY
[0012] The present invention is a footrest for a shower. The footrest enables a user to rest a foot above the shower floor while bathing or shaving.
[0013] In various embodiments, the footrest of the present invention includes a footrest element which has a contour which is concaved as viewed from above. Thus, the side portions of the top surface are raised with respect to the center region of the surface. By shaping the footrest in this fashion, slipping in the lateral direction is resisted.
[0014] In various embodiments, the footrest includes mounting flanges extending upward or downward from sides of the footrest element. The flanges are adapted to be mounted to the walls of the shower, and are generally at a right angle to one another. Mounting is via an adhesive, or screws, or any other suitable mounting method.
[0015] Ideally, the surface of the footrest element is shaped to substantially conform to the shape of a portion of a cone. In this way, the footrest can be deformed by applying pressure to the top surface or lower surface of the footrest element. The material used to form the footrest element is rigid, and will hold its shape, yet can be deformed by applying an amount of pressure past a threshold amount and will hold its new shape after being deformed. This conical shape is specially adapted to enable the device to be deformed in such a way that the mounting flanges will be aligned with the shower walls in the event the device is deformed to conform to shower walls which are formed at an angle a small amount wider or narrower than 90 degrees.
[0016] Cutout openings in the footrest element, in various embodiments, resist slipping in the forward or backward direction. The cutout openings may also provide a passage for mounting screws through the mounting flanges. The cutout openings ideally have a shape which includes side edges which are substantially shaped as an arc of a circle. They may be concentric with a front edge arc of the footrest element.
[0017] The back of the device ideally includes an opening which is adapted to receive a cosmetic object such as a razor or other item. The item can be conveniently stored in this back opening out of the way of the general usable area of the shower stall.

DETAILED DESCRIPTION OF THE INVENTION
[0023] While this invention is susceptible of embodiments in many different forms, there are shown in the drawings and will herein be described in detail, preferred embodiments of the invention with the understanding that the present disclosure is to be considered as an exemplification of the principles of the invention and is not intended to limit the broad aspect of the invention to the embodiments illustrated.
[0024] The present invention is a footrest device for a shower 10. The footrest device 10 includes a footrest element 15.
[0025] In various embodiments, the footrest element 15 is shaped to conform to a corner of a shower stall and adapted to receive at least a portion of a user's foot. The footrest element 15 includes a top surface 20 having a concave curvature as viewed from above. In this manner, the side areas of the top surface 20 will be raised with respect to a central region of the surface 20, which will create resistance to slipping in the lateral direction.
[0026] In various embodiments, the footrest element 15 is adapted to be mounted in the corner of shower stall. When mounted in a corner, a front portion 25 of the footrest element 15 is positioned at a lower height than a back portion 30 of the footrest element 15. This configuration is convenient and comfortable for a user to place a foot atop the footrest element 15. It also may assist in reducing slipping in the frontwards direction.
[0027] In certain embodiments, the concave curvature of the top surface 20 of the footrest element 15 substantially conforms to the shape of a portion of a surface of a cone. In other words, the surface 20 is conical in shape, the front portion being wider than the rear portion. As described below, this shape is particular suitable in embodiments in which a mounting angle is adjustable. Also, since the device narrows toward the rear, this shape assists in resisting slipping in the frontward direction.
[0028] Ideally, the footrest 10 includes at least two mounting flanges 35 extending from edges of the footrest element 15. The flanges 35 are generally at right angles with respect to one another, though this angle may be adjustable. Ideally, the flanges 35 and footrest element 15 are formed of one integral formation of material. The flanges 35 may extend upward or downward from the surface 20 of the footrest element 15. In the embodiments illustrated herein, the flanges 35 extend downward. The flanges 35 are used to mount the device 10 to the shower walls. Mounting may be via an adhesive on an outer surface of the flanges 35, or via screws passing through screw holes 50 in the flanges 35.
[0029] In various embodiments, the footrest surface 20 includes at least one cutout opening 40. The cutouts may be aligned and adapted to allow screws to be driven through the through-holes via in the flanges 35 reaching such screws with a screwdriver shaft through the cutout openings 40. Ideally, two such cutout openings 40 are provided. The cutout openings 40 are adapted to resist slipping of a user's foot in the forward or backward direction.
[0030] In various embodiments, the front edge of the footrest element 15 is shaped as a circular arc having a center directed toward the corner of a shower stall when mounted. The cutout openings 40 ideally include two cutout openings 40. Ideally, the cutout openings 40 have side edges shaped as circular arcs formed concentric to the arc of the front edge of the footrest element 15. Thus, they will be well adapted to resist slipping forward or backward, and will provide suitable clearance for driving screws through the screw holes 50.
[0031] In certain embodiments, the footrest element 15 has a corner cutout section 45 at its back edge adapted to receive and store a grooming item such as a razor or other item.
[0032] Ideally, in various embodiments, the footrest device 10 has an adjustable mounting angle such that it can be mounted in corners in which the walls do not meet at an exact 90 degree angle. Thus, the device can be adjusted to allow for an obtuse or acute angle. The device 10 is ideally formed of a rigid material, and has a surface which is resistant to oxidation and corrosion. The device 10 may be formed of metal, such as aluminum or steel, stainless steel, or plastic, or any other suitable material.
[0033] In various embodiments, the footrest element 15 can be bent out of shape by applying pressure exceeding a threshold level to a lower surface of the footrest element 15. The application of such pressure widens the mounting angle, and the footrest element 15 maintains a new shape. Similarly, the footrest element 15 can be bent out of shape by applying pressure exceeding a threshold level to an upper surface of the footrest element 15. The application of such pressure narrows the mounting angle, and the footrest element 15 maintains a new shape. When the footrest surface 20 conforms to a substantially conical shape, the deformation described will result in the flanges 35 being positioned to suitably mount to walls having various angles of intersection. The shape allows the flanges 35 to remain substantially in parallel planes to the shower walls even after deformation of the footrest element 15 to adjust to a particular corner angle.
